What Is Low Volume Manufacturing?


Low volume manufacturing refers to producing small batches of parts—typically from 50 to 100,000 units. It allows businesses to quickly test markets, validate designs, and accelerate product launches without committing to expensive mass production tooling.


This approach is ideal for:


Product development and validation

Pre-production runs

Bridge production before mass manufacturing

On-demand manufacturing for niche markets

Our Capabilities From Design to Delivery


1. CNC Machining

3-axis, 4-axis, and 5-axis precision machining


Aluminum, steel, brass, plastics, and more


Tight tolerance ±0.01mm


2. Vacuum Casting

Fast production of plastic prototypes and functional parts


Suitable for 20–100 units with low tooling cost


3. Rapid Tooling & Injection Molding

Bridge tool molds for 100–100,000 parts


Short lead time, perfect for functional testing and pilot production


4. 3D Printing (SLA, SLS, SLM)

Complex geometries, no tooling required


Prototypes and functional parts
